Finding predictable approaches for root surface biomodification is an important challenge in the treatment of gingival recession. This study sought to assess the root coverage percentage by subepithelial connective tissue graft (SCTG) following root surface conditioning with erbium, chromium: yttrium scandium gallium garnet (Er,Cr:YSGG) laser.
In this split-mouth, randomized clinical trial, 30 teeth with Miller's Class I and II gingival recession were treated with SCTG (the Langer and Langer technique) with (case group) or without (control group) root surface conditioning with Er,Cr:YSGG laser (wavelength=2780 nm, power=0.75 W, H mode, repetition rate=20 Hz). Recession depth (RD), recession width (RW), clinical attachment level (CAL), and probing depth (PD) were assessed at the baseline (one week before surgery) and at 2 and 6 months postoperatively. The amount of root coverage was quantified in the two groups. Data were analyzed using Friedman test and Wilcoxon signed-rank test.
No significant difference was noted between the case and control groups in any parameter (P>0.05). Significant improvement occurred in all the measured parameters in the two groups after surgery (P<0.05). The mean root coverage at the end of the study period was 87% and 80% in the case and control groups, respectively (P=0.244), and complete root coverage was achieved in 66% and 60% of the samples in the case and control groups, respectively.
Root surface conditioning by Er,Cr:YSGG laser improved the mean root coverage and the percentage of complete root coverage. However, these changes were not statistically significant.
